This fully welded, corrosion-resistant Ford Mustang trailer hitch receiver is perfect for your light-duty towing needs. Draw-Tite's Tested Tough guarantee ensures that this hitch exceeds industry standards. Drawbar sold separately.


Features:

  • Custom-fit trailer hitch lets you tow a trailer or carry a bike rack or cargo carrier with your vehicle
  • Computer-aided, fully welded steel construction ensures strength and durability
  • Tested Tough - safety and reliability criteria exceed industry standards
  • Bolt-on installation - no welding required
    • Complete hardware kit and installation instructions included
  • Lifetime technical support from the experts at etrailer.com
  • Black powder coat finish covers e-coat base for superior rust protection
  • Sturdy, square-tube design
  • Drawbar and pin and clip sold separately


Specs:

  • Receiver opening: 1-1/4" x 1-1/4"
  • Rating: Class I
    • Maximum gross trailer weight: 2,000 lbs
    • Maximum tongue weight: 200 lbs
  • Limited lifetime warranty


Draw-Tite Tested Tough

Draw-Tite Tested Tough

Draw-Tite's Tested Tough program provides testing standards far superior to those outlined by the Society of Automotive Engineers (SAE), the go-to source for engineering professionals.



Each Draw-Tite trailer hitch receiver undergoes extensive fatigue testing and static testing with the ball mount that is either supplied or recommended for use with that particular hitch, thus ensuring results that are applicable to real life use. Fatigue testing is also conducted on hitches rated for use with weight-distribution systems.


In addition, Draw-Tite performs static testing on a simulated automobile, as opposed to the rigid fixture used for SAE testing, resulting in a more true-to-life scenario.

I bought this hitch for my 2012 Mustang to tow an extra wheel/tire set and tools to track events, and occasionally a motorcycle, large tools, furniture, a bike rack, etc.. I haven't used it yet, but the hitch seems pretty sturdy. The hitch and hardware combined were just under 20lbs, which is pretty darn good from a performance standpoint. The powder coat isn't perfect but certainly acceptable for a hitch. My only gripe is that the hitch frame brackets on mine were slightly off. The drivers side bracket wasn't quite perpendicular to the frame, so tightening the fastener to the torque specification caused a bit of a deformation on the frame. I'm not too concerned about it, it should still be ok, but it's definitely not ideal. I don't know for sure because my exhaust system isn't in yet, but there does appear to be clearance for most stock and aftermarket mufflers. I do not think there is clearance for quad tip mufflers (such as 13-14 Shelby GT500 mufflers) so be aware of that if you have or would like to add quad tips. Otherwise, it is a fairly discrete hitch that should help make your Mustang much more practical.

The hitch looks great installed. The basic concept of the installation is pretty straight forward but if your car is not brand new like the one in the video, it won't be quite that easy. Prying the rubber insulator off was easier than expected. I experienced the first problem undoing the muffler clamp. The bolt head broke right off. I was eventually able to get the stud out of it rusty coffin. When I was finally ready to install the hitch, the backing plates didn't fit through the frame access hole. NOT ONE OF THEM FIT!!!. The backing plates were poorly stamped and very rough. Mine exhibited excess flashing on the sheared edges. I had to use a grinder to clean them up. Access hole diam= .980", backing plates= 1.060"
Lost a leader in the frame, spent a lot of time fishing out the wire ,bolt and nut. Need longer wire.( cheep fix).
The rest of the install was easy and I had a perfect fit.
Looks great, not an obvious ugly attachment which is nice for my beautiful convertible.
The hitch is top notch, just need a nicer hardware package.

I installed this hitch on a 2014 Mustang GT Premium. The fit and finish was excellent, the fishwires worked perfectly and the instructions were precise and clear. Installing the hitch itself was an easy 5-minute job. However, both mufflers need to be removed. This was an exasperating, difficult and time-consuming problem, and reinstalling them with the hitch in place was even worse. This is NOT a problem with the hitch. When everything was back together, it fit perfectly - nothing is touching or rubbing anything else that shouldn't be. The only other caution I have is that the receiver is buried pretty far under and forward of the rear bumper - maybe an extension is a good idea. Overall, a first-rate product.

I love the product. I had a bit of an issue with the instructions. I'd never used any bolt leads before. I felt that if there had been some instruction on how to screw the bolts into the leads and also how far to screw them it would have saved me a lot of time. Specifically I screwed the bolt onto the lead only enough so that the wire was completely around the bolt. When pulling the bolt through the frame everything worked great. The problem came when trying to push the washer / nut onto the bolt. The bolt lead wire was blocking (because it was on the end of the bolt) screwing on the nut. So I had to unwind the bolt lead wire as I screwed on the nut. So for anyone reading this... When you screw the bolt into the lead wire screw it as far as it will go. That way the end of the bolt when pulled through is easy to screw on the nut.
